Alfa and Maserati will share the floor pan?
Fiat and Maserati are working on a new platform, which will be used in the Maserati Quattroporte successors, and Granturismo ... 8C Competizione successor. The new platform is to have a high content of aluminum, said the informant InsideLine. This will help to reduce weight, which hurts the current over-Maserati. The platform will certainly posterior propulsion, will be able to use new hybrid from Ferrari.
The official date of introduction of the platform is not yet known, but the Quattroporte successor must occur for 2-3 years. Alfa Romeo has used the platform for a new car and coupe kabrio. It is not known whether the car will be produced in limited quantity or serial production occurs.
